#9: Instant Pot Whole Frozen Chicken

Jackie said, “it was cooked perfectly and fell off the bone. The best part was the broth in the bottom. Made some rice and veggies and had instant chicken soup. Perfect for the chilly evening we had.”

Instant Pot Whole Frozen Chicken
How to cook a whole frozen chicken in your Instant Pot--If you love getting those whole rotisserie chickens at your grocery store, you'll love this recipe for pressure cooker whole seasoned chicken. The chicken is cooked in minutes in your Instant Pot (my chicken was actually totally frozen) and then stuck under the broiler to crisp up the skin. Slice the chicken up to eat plain or use it in any recipes that call for cooked chicken.

    Can/Have you used frozen chicken breasts in your recipes? (along with the other ingredients) If so, how much longer do you allow for the frozen chicken to cook?

    Reply
    • Karen says

      January 1, 2020 at 5:24 pm

      Yes I use frozen all the time. A lot of my recipes specify in the actual recipe what time to use for frozen chicken. But usually I go about 3 extra minutes for frozen.
